Output fea537a1679cb076dee3c5412bfddc71f86d6d09470786404cb2a9960b51a8c5:11

value
2327528751
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23d7bf44f9c4f3658913d9c1373cd58181e75e44 OP_EQUAL
address
34xY2ddSMbKQyBJMSMePdNnW9Luzhwyt2k
transaction
fea537a1679cb076dee3c5412bfddc71f86d6d09470786404cb2a9960b51a8c5
spent
true